Key Responsibilities

·        Draft, review, and negotiate sales, purchase, and supply contracts for physical commodity trades.

·        Ensure contracts accurately reflect agreed commercial terms (pricing, quantity, delivery terms,

Incoterms, etc.).

·        Align contracts with trading strategies and operational capabilities to ensure seamless execution.

·        Maintain contract lifecycle management from deal capture through to execution and closeout.

·        Ensure timely issuance, confirmation, and execution of contracts to support trading activities.

·        Identify, assess, and mitigate contractual, operational, and financial risks in trading agreements.

·        Ensure compliance with company policies, regulatory requirements, and global trade standards.

·        Review contract clauses (e.g., force majeure, indemnity, liability, dispute resolution) to safeguard

company interests.

·        Monitor contractual obligations and ensure adherence by internal stakeholders and counterparties.

·        Partner with traders to structure contracts that optimize margins and reduce risk exposure.

·        Provide insights into pricing mechanisms, cost components, and contractual implications on P&L.

·        Support dispute resolution and claims management, including quantity/quality disputes, delays, and

penalties.

·        Ensure accurate interpretation of contract terms in financial settlements and invoicing.

·        Contribute to cost recovery and revenue protection through strong contract governance.

·        Liaise with traders, operators, legal teams, and finance to resolve contract-related issues.

·        Coordinate with suppliers, customers, and external parties to clarify and negotiate contract terms.

·        Support supplier performance management by ensuring contracts reflect operational realities.

·        Develop and standardize contract templates and clauses for efficiency and consistency.

·        Identify process gaps and implement improvements to strengthen contract management practices.

·        Maintain contract databases and tracking systems to monitor obligations and performance.

·        Provide reporting on contract status, risks, disputes, and compliance metrics.

·        Support digitalization and automation initiatives in contract lifecycle management.
